NSL Insider - Suns - Warriors Review

by jessedunne, updated on Wednesday, May 06 2020, 07:03 am EST

 
What a series. Where do I start. Let’s go right back to When Clay took over The Warriors. He came in with a brash attitude. He wanted to win and let everyone know it. It was a breath of fresh air (to everyone besides Gav, who decided straight away Clay was is New Enemy Number 1). The Warriors had been awful in the old NLL for years and years. Mainly because Joel kept ripping them off in trades.
So you have this new up and coming side. Against the old firm. Laddas. A 2k Legend. On the quest for that elusive title. Laddas won 55 games, Clay won 46. 95% of experts picked The Suns. No one gave The Warriors a chance. Fast forward 4 games and they lead 3-1. Against all odds. They have the series in the bag? 3 chances to eliminate one of the big dogs in the first round and shake up The West.
Unfortunately from there, is where Clays nightmare began. Laddas locked in, he ignored his wife and kids and didn’t shower for 96 straight hours. He simmed and he simmed and he simmed. He never lost faith either. 3-1, especially in 2K is a bad place to be. But Laddas backed his guys. He made a few changes and made some big calls. CP3 to the bench, Rozier out of the rotation completely. AND IT WORKED!
They worked hard and one Game 5 at home. The big one was back at The Chase Centre. Warriors had a chance to close at home. The Suns were down big in this one, but some how found a way to claw back and get the win. An absolute famous effort. 

 
Game 7, had it all. A tight battle, then a computer crash and a re-sim. The re-sim started close but in the end the Suns showed their class and closed it our comfortably. An amazing effort to come back form 3-1 down. 
Hats off to The Warriors. They took a franchise that was going no where fast. They have made them competitive and relevant in a short period of time. This loss will sting for a while. But they have better things to come. Well done clay and good luck to Laddas in the 2nd Round.
